            <p> Key to the genus  Lathraea</p>
            <p>1. Flowers arising directly from stem at ground-level ......................................................................................................................... 2</p>
            <p>- Flowers borne on a spicate or racemose inflorescence .................................................................................................................... 3</p>
            <p> 2. Calyx distinctly 4-lobed; corolla 30–90 mm long; c. 4 seeds ...................................................................... 2.  Lathraea clandestina</p>
            <p> - Calyx unlobed with undulate margin, corolla 19–25 mm long; c. 15–20 seeds .............................................. 5.  Lathraea purpurea</p>
            <p> 3. Inflorescence distinctly unilateral; c. 80 seeds; fruit dehiscing passively ..................................................... 1.  Lathraea squamaria</p>
            <p>- Inflorescence not unilateral, flowers densely spirally arranged; c. 4 seeds; fruit dehiscing explosively ......................................... 4</p>
            <p> 4. Inflorescence 200–500(–700) mm tall, bright yellow in fruit; bract 12–14 mm long in fruit; fruit bright yellow; native to Balkan Peninsula .......................................................................................................................................................... 3.  Lathraea rhodopea</p>
            <p> - Inflorescence 100–300(–400) mm tall; white to cream in fruit; bract 6–9 mm long in fruit; fruit whitish-cream to pale purple; native to China, Japan and Korea ................................................................................................................................ 4.  Lathraea japonica</p>
